The paper covers the results of the GATT Uruguay Round negotiations , and characterises the negotiations carried out within the WTO. The results o f the WTO Ministerial Conferences in Seattle, Doha, Cancún and Hong Kong have been presented, and the reforms to the CAP have been shown in the light of the WTO negotiation accomplishments. In result o f the agricultural decisions taken at the WTO level, the EU undertook to limit its protectionist agricultural policy. However, a complete resignation from support to that specific sector o f the EU economy is impossible. Therefore, certain measures towards the re-orientation of the CAP have been taken, enabling the Community to secure grounds for its sustained development.
